The Fujifilm X100F has a dedicated shutter speed dial and an aperture ring on the lens, allowing you to adjust both settings quickly without diving into menus. This makes manual shooting intuitive and fast.

Use the Film Simulation feature to enhance the mood of your photos. For travel and street photography, try Classic Chrome for a subtle, muted look, or Velvia for vibrant landscapes.

Activate Focus Peaking in the X100F's menu to highlight in-focus areas with a colored outline. This is especially helpful for precise focusing in portraits and bokeh shots.

The X100F's electronic viewfinder (EVF) allows you to see a live histogram overlay, helping you balance your exposure before taking the shot. This feature is useful in all shooting scenarios.

Switch to the Silent Shutter mode on the X100F for discreet shooting in quiet environments or when you don't want to disturb your subjects, perfect for street and portrait photography.
